Located at 3900 Macedonia Rd, in Powder Springs, Georgia, Tapp Middle School is a middle-of-the-pack middle school that educates 809 students (grades 6 through 8), overseen by Cobb County.
Cobb County comprises 110 schools with combined enrollment of 105,738 students; Tapp Middle School is among them.
Demographically, Tapp Middle School reports that 58% of the student body identifies as Black. Other groups include 29% Hispanic, 6% White, 6% multiracial. By comparison, Cobb County as a whole is about 27% Black, so the school skews noticeably more Black than its surroundings.
On the income-and-resources front, The school reports having 54 full-time-equivalent teachers, for a student-teacher ratio near 14.9:1. That figure is higher than the state norm's 14.1:1 average. Roughly 87% of students at Tapp Middle School qualify for free or reduced-price lunch, which schools and policymakers use as a rough income-mix signal. That share is north of Cobb County's rate of about 53%.
After controlling for student poverty, Tapp Middle School performs roughly as the BeatsExpectations model predicts for a school with this FRL share. The predicted value is around 32.2%, the actual is 42.9%, a residual of +10.7 points.
In the broader community, Cobb County reports that median household earnings sit near $102,738, roughly 51% of adults have completed at least a four-year degree, and the poverty rate sits near 6%. Across Cobb County's 129 public schools (combined enrollment of about 116,609 students), Tapp Middle School is one campus in the mix.
Compton Elementary School is the nearest neighboring public school, about 0.7 miles from this campus. 8 of the 8 nearest public schools sit inside a five-mile radius. Among the 8 schools in that immediate cluster with test data (this one included), Tapp Middle School ranks 2nd on composite proficiency, above the local average of 36.6%.
Tapp Middle School operates from a bedroom-community location.
Over the past 7-year window. Over the past 7-year window, the student count declined 10%: 901 students in 2018 compared to 809 in 2025. Hispanic enrollment moved from 23% to 29% across the same window. Class-load math has narrowed: from 17.8:1 in 2018 to 14.9:1 in 2025.
